How many championships have the Mavericks won?

The Dallas Mavericks have won one championship in franchise history and it might be one of the most memorable championships. In the 2011 NBA Finals, the Mavericks led by Dirk Nowitzki defeated the Miami Heat and their infamous Big-3 of LeBron James, Dwyane Wade, and Chris Bosh in six games. This title was the crowning achievement of Nowitzki’s career, which had been a subject of ridicule for many analysts and experts.

Dallas Mavericks Finals Appearance history

In the Dallas Mavericks’ franchise history, the team has made the Finals for the third time as of June 2024. Their first two instances came in in 2006 and 2011, and ironically, both were against the same opponent — the Miami Heat. The Mavericks have a 1-2 record in the Finals after falling short against the Celtics in the 2024 NBA Finals.

What teams did the Mavericks lose the championship Finals against?

The Mavericks have lost in the NBA Finals twice from three attempts. they lost in 2006 to the Miami Heat and in 2024 against the Boston Celtics.

In the series against the Heat in 2006, the Mavericks started the series with two wins but then proceeded to lose four straight games to lose the series 4-2. Against the Celtics, the Mavericks were never in the series as they fell into 0-3 hole and eventually lost 1-4.
